What Happens After the Fertilisation?

What Happens After the Fertilisation

Pregnancy technically begins when a sperm has successfully fertilised an egg to form a zygote. This typically occurs between 12 and 24 hours after ovulation. The instant the fertilisation is complete, the zygote embarks along the fallopian tube, actively dividing as it travels towards the uterus. The next 48 to 72 hours are important, although a woman might not realise that conception has occurred.

Most women at this point will not have any visible symptoms. However, slight body changes may begin as hormonal changes start preparing the uterine lining for implantation. These are very slight signs and can be difficult to notice, but may give clues to those trying to conceive.

What Happens 72 Hours After Conception?

The 72 hours after conception, symptoms may remain subtle, but important biological activities are still underway. Throughout this period, the fertilised egg is making its way down the fallopian tube to the uterus and takes about 3-5 days to enter the uterus.Cell division accelerates, and the blastocyst (an early-stage embryo) begins to form.

A few women experience a sensation of warmth in the lower abdomen, fullness or even increased vaginal discharge. These are all manifestations of hormonal activity as the body begins to adapt to potential implantation.

It should be noted that though these symptoms are often linked to pregnancy, they can also mimic signs of ovulation or a normal menstrual cycle. They can therefore not qualify as conclusive indicators of pregnancy before appropriate testing and clinical confirmation have been performed.

Understanding Very Early Signs:

The very early pregnancy signs, are often observed before a missed period. Vaginal discharge may be increased and It is usually milky white and odourless, and is completely normal. It is caused by increased vaginal blood flow and hormonal imbalance, particularly because of the high levels of estrogen.

Besides discharge women may observe:

● Breast tenderness or swelling in the breast

● Increased frequency of visits to the loo

● Slight lower back pain

● Bloating, sometimes mistaken as a sign that the period is about to arrive.

Monitoring such symptoms can help individuals to better understand their bodies and differentiate between initial signs of pregnancy and the onset of menstruation.

When Should You See a Doctor?

Although early pregnancy symptoms are usually mild, if you experience the following, it is advisable to consult a medical practitioner:

● Severe or prolonged cramping

● Heavy bleeding or abnormal discharge

● Persistent fatigue or dizziness

● Misconception regarding symptoms and the need for clarification

FAQs

1. What are the signs 72 hours after conception?

Within 72 hours after conception, common signs may include mild cramps, slight spotting or increased discharge. However, these are subtle and often go unnoticed.

2. Can you feel pregnancy symptoms in the first 72 hours?

Yes, some women may experience the first 72 hours of pregnancy symptoms like fatigue, light spotting, and a slight increase in vaginal discharge, although they are typically mild.

3. What kind of discharge indicates a very early pregnancy?

A milky white, thin, and odourless discharge can be a very early sign of pregnancy. This is due to hormonal shifts, especially a rise in estrogen levels.

4. When should I take a pregnancy test after noticing early symptoms?

It’s best to wait until at least the first day of a missed period to take a pregnancy test, as hormone levels need time to rise to detectable levels.

5. Can early pregnancy symptoms be confused with premenstrual symptoms?

Yes, early pregnancy signs such as cramps, mood changes, and fatigue can be similar to PMS. Monitoring your cycle and noting any changes can help distinguish between the two.
